The Three Climate Zones of Secluded Oregon Living

Oregon’s secluded neighborhoods fall into three distinct climate zones, each with its own construction requirements. The Coast Range receives 80 to 120 inches of rain annually and sits in a moderate temperature band where frost is rare near the ocean but persistent in the inland valleys. The Cascade foothills, where Brightwood sits, experience a true mountain climate with heavy snow above 3,000 feet and a shorter building season. The high desert east of the Cascades drops to 10 to 15 inches of precipitation per year but subjects buildings to extreme diurnal temperature swings and high UV exposure. The Wallowa Valley towns near Hells Canyon exemplify this eastern climate, where summers top 90 degrees and winters drop below zero, demanding building assemblies that handle both extremes.

ZoneAnnual PrecipitationTemp RangeFrost DepthBuilding Season
Coast Range80–120 in.35–75°F12 in.Year-round (wet)
Cascade foothills50–80 in.20–85°F24 in.May – October
High desert / eastern10–15 in.0–100°F30 in.April – November

Building in Oregon’s Forested Foothills: The Brightwood Example

Brightwood sits at roughly 1,200 feet elevation on U.S. Route 26, about 45 miles east of Portland in Clackamas County. The community is surrounded by Mount Hood National Forest, with the Sandy River cutting through the valley floor. Homes here sit on lots ranging from one to ten acres, nestled among Douglas fir, western hemlock, and cedar. The year-round population numbers only a few hundred, but seasonal residents and vacation homeowners swell the number during summer and ski season. Building in this environment requires attention to wildfire risk, steep-slope grading, and well-water reliability.

Wildfire-Resistant Construction Standards

Clackamas County lies within Oregon’s Wildland-Urban Interface (WUI) zone, which triggers special building code requirements for new construction. Exterior walls must use ignition-resistant materials such as fiber-cement siding, stucco, or treated lumber. Decks and porches need a minimum of two feet of clearance from flammable vegetation and must be built with fire-retardant-treated wood or composite decking. Roofs must carry a Class A fire rating, and eaves need to be boxed or enclosed to prevent ember intrusion. These requirements add approximately 8 to 12 percent to exterior finishing costs compared to a non-WUI project, but they are non-negotiable anywhere within the Mount Hood National Forest boundary.

Steep-Slope Site Preparation

Many building sites in the Brightwood area have slopes exceeding 15 percent. Steep-slope construction requires engineered retaining walls, stepped footings, and carefully managed drainage. Cut-and-fill operations must be approved by the Clackamas County Department of Transportation and Development, with a geotechnical engineer’s report required for any fill exceeding four feet in height. The cost of site work on a steep lot typically runs $15,000 to $35,000 more than a flat lot of the same size, but the trade-off is privacy and views that flat lots cannot match.

Property Development in Eastern Oregon’s River Valleys

Eastern Oregon’s river valleys, including the John Day River corridor and the Wallowa Valley, offer a completely different building environment. Wide-open skies, juniper-studded hillsides, and dramatic basalt canyons define the terrain. The John Day River Valley, one of the longest free-flowing rivers in the continental United States, runs through Wheeler, Grant, and Gilliam counties. Property here is significantly cheaper than in the western part of the state, with raw land prices often below $2,000 per acre for unimproved parcels. Development in the John Day River Valley towns requires careful water rights management and a different set of construction priorities than the wet western slopes.

Water Rights and Well Drilling in Eastern Oregon

Water is the critical constraint for eastern Oregon development. New wells require a water right permit from the Oregon Water Resources Department, and approval can take 6 to 18 months in basins that are not designated as fully appropriated. In the John Day basin, groundwater availability varies widely by formation. Wells in the alluvial valley bottoms can produce 10 to 30 gallons per minute from depths of 50 to 150 feet, while upland basalt wells may need to go 300 to 500 feet and produce less than 5 GPM. Drilling costs in eastern Oregon run $25 to $45 per foot, so a deep basalt well can cost $12,000 to $22,000. Rainwater collection systems are legal for residential use and provide a supplementary source for landscaping and livestock.

Coastal Seclusion: Building in the Oregon Coast Range

The Oregon Coast Range creates a narrow band of seclusion between the Pacific Ocean and the interior valleys. Communities here sit in a unique climate: high rainfall, moderate temperatures, and persistent fog for months at a time. The salt-laden air accelerates corrosion of metal fasteners, flashing, and HVAC equipment. Builders working in the Oregon Coast Range for property development must specify materials that withstand years of marine exposure.

Marine-Grade Material Specifications

Exterior-grade 316 stainless steel fasteners and hangers are non-negotiable within 10 miles of the coastline. Hot-dipped galvanized hardware with a minimum G-90 coating serves in lower-exposure sites but should be inspected every three years. Windows must be double-glazed with Low-E coating and have a minimum design pressure rating of DP-50 to withstand coastal storm winds. Continuous exterior insulation with drainage cavities prevents moisture entrapment behind siding. Fiber-cement or cedar shingle siding outlasts vinyl in the salt-fog environment, typically delivering 30 to 50 years of service before needing replacement.

  • Use 316 stainless steel for all exterior fasteners, hangers, and flashing
  • Install a sealed vapor barrier with a perm rating below 1.0 on the warm side
  • Specify ground-mount or wall-mount mini-splits with coastal-rated coil coatings
  • Budget for annual deck and siding inspections to catch corrosion early

Infrastructure and Utilities for Remote Oregon Properties

Secluded Oregon neighborhoods rarely provide municipal utilities. Property owners arrange their own power, water, and waste treatment. In Brightwood, electrical service from Portland General Electric costs $3,000 to $7,000 for a new residential drop depending on the distance from the nearest pole. In the John Day Valley, rural electric cooperatives such as Columbia Basin Electric provide service but connection distances beyond a quarter mile can push costs over $10,000. Septic systems are the norm everywhere, and the Oregon Department of Environmental Quality requires a site evaluation by a licensed designer before any system can be installed.

Broadband and Connectivity

Internet access varies dramatically across Oregon’s secluded zones. Brightwood residents near Highway 26 can get cable broadband from Spectrum at up to 300 Mbps. Deeper into the Mount Hood National Forest, speeds drop to 10 to 25 Mbps via DSL or fixed wireless. Eastern Oregon properties in the John Day and Wallowa valleys rely on Starlink satellite internet almost exclusively, with typical speeds of 50 to 200 Mbps. Fiber optic expansion is underway along Highway 26 and parts of the Columbia Gorge, but most remote southeastern Oregon communities remain dependent on satellite for the foreseeable future.

Property Value Trends and Market Outlook

Secluded Oregon properties have followed different value trajectories depending on their proximity to urban employment centers. Brightwood and the Mount Hood corridor have seen strong appreciation driven by remote workers moving from Portland, with median home prices rising roughly 10 percent annually since 2020. Eastern Oregon river valley properties have appreciated more slowly, at 3 to 5 percent per year, but start from a lower base. The Wallowa Valley and John Day areas offer entry prices for raw land that remain accessible to first-time rural property buyers.
